-
Type: Task
-
Resolution: Fixed
-
Priority: Major - P3
-
Affects Version/s: None
-
Component/s: None
-
Query Execution
-
Fully Compatible
-
QE 2024-03-04, QE 2024-03-18
-
169
The PQS project just became way more important than we thought it would be, and it's not a query only feature any more.
We would like to always calculate the query shape and hash regardless of whether there are any active query settings, so that performance impacts will be consistent and not dependent on whether there are any query settings on any given collection.
Of course, this doesn't apply in case of ID_HACK queries.
- fixes
-
SERVER-84079 Introduce query settings Genny performance tests
- Closed
-
SERVER-86488 Ensure query settings are set on collections used in high value workloads for query settings sys-perf variants
- Closed
- is depended on by
-
SERVER-87382 Make $queryStats take advantage of QueryShape (and its hash) being always computed
- Backlog
- related to
-
SERVER-87040 Create dedicated lookupQuerySettingsFor<Command> methods in query settings module
- Closed